About 5221 Claremont Street
Fully updated Craftsman bungalow offering built-in income and energy independence in Houston’s East End Revitalized area.
This single-story home features an open layout with updated kitchen, bathrooms, flooring, new closets, and a new driveway. New roof installed in 2025 with lifetime warranty provides long-term peace of mind.
A rare energy package includes solar panels, Tesla Powerwall battery backup, SPAN smart electrical panel, and Tesla EV charger, offering protection from rising energy costs and backup power during outages.
The detached two-car garage includes a 1 bed / 1 bath garage apartment with private entry, currently rented month-to-month for $1,000/month (tenant willing to renew or vacate). Ideal for house hacking or investment income.
Minutes from Downtown, EaDo, and major freeways. Can be sold as a package with 5217 Claremont St next door.
Perfect for owner-occupants or investors seeking income, efficiency, and long-term upside.
